Michael "peter pan" Jackson Making a Comeback?
December 15, 2005
The star will release one song every week for the next five months,
starting with 'Don't Stop 'Til You Get Enough', which will hit shops
next month.
A source told Britain's The Sun newspaper: “Michael is determined to get back in the charts.
“He hopes his devoted fans will buy them all.”
